Why 6509 S. Fort Hood Street Deserves Attention
The emails released to KDH News don't tell the full story, but they don't need to. The fact that a specific parcel is being discussed at all—with zoning as a central consideration—signals that someone has already done preliminary site work. Data center developers don't float addresses casually. Site selection is an expensive, methodical process involving power capacity studies, fiber route analysis, and environmental assessments before a street address ever makes it into an email chain.
When a specific address enters the conversation alongside zoning language, it usually means the project is further along than anyone is publicly admitting.
The Fort Hood area, anchored by one of the largest U.S. military installations in the country, brings some structural advantages that pure real estate metrics don't fully capture. Military-adjacent zones often benefit from pre-existing heavy electrical infrastructure, wide road access for large equipment transport, and land parcels large enough to accommodate the sprawling footprint that modern data centers require. A hyperscale facility can easily cover 100,000 to 500,000 square feet, and that kind of square footage requires land that most urban markets simply can't offer at a competitive price.
Zoning: The Variable That Makes or Breaks the Deal
Data center zoning is one of those unglamorous topics that determines whether a billion-dollar project gets built or quietly dies in a planning commission meeting. Most jurisdictions weren't writing zoning codes with data centers in mind—they were written for manufacturing plants, warehouses, and office parks. Data centers occupy an awkward middle ground: they look like industrial facilities, but they generate minimal truck traffic, few jobs per square foot, and enormous power draw.
That last point—power—is where zoning conversations get complicated fast. A mid-sized data center might pull 20 to 50 megawatts from the local grid. A hyperscale campus can demand 200 MW or more. Local utilities and planning departments in smaller Texas markets are increasingly caught off guard by these numbers, and zoning classifications don't always account for the unique load profiles involved.
The zoning hurdles at a site like 6509 S. Fort Hood Street aren't necessarily dealbreakers—but they'll shape the timeline, the footprint, and ultimately the economics of anything built there.
Developers typically navigate this through a combination of rezoning petitions, planned development overlays, or special use permits. Each path has a different risk profile. A straight rezoning takes time and invites public opposition. A special use permit is faster but limits future flexibility. Sophisticated developers usually have a preferred approach going in, and which path they choose reveals how confident they are in local political support for the project.
Infrastructure: The Real Due Diligence Question
Zoning is the legal question. Infrastructure is the practical one. For any Fort Hood data center project to be viable, several boxes need to be checked simultaneously.
Power is the most critical. Texas's ERCOT grid has faced well-documented reliability challenges, and large load additions get scrutinized carefully. Oncor or other transmission providers serving the Killeen-Fort Hood area would need to confirm available capacity or commit to grid upgrades—a process that can take 18 to 36 months and add significant cost.
Fiber connectivity is non-negotiable. A data center without diverse, redundant fiber routes is a liability, not an asset. The Fort Hood corridor benefits from proximity to major Texas thoroughfares, but fiber density in this particular submarket would need independent verification. Carriers like Zayo, Lumen, or regional fiber operators would need existing or buildable routes to the site.
Water access matters more than most people realize. Cooling is one of the largest operational costs in a data center, and many facilities use water-cooled systems that can consume millions of gallons annually. In Central Texas, where water rights and drought conditions are persistent concerns, this factor alone can derail a project that looks viable on every other dimension.
The military installation itself is both a neighbor and a factor. Fort Hood—recently redesignated as Fort Cavazos—represents a stable, long-term anchor for the surrounding community. That stability translates to predictable local governance and a workforce accustomed to technical and security-oriented employment, which matters for data center staffing even if the headcount numbers are modest compared to traditional industrial employers.
The Investment Case: What This Means for Land and Capital
For investors tracking land development opportunities in Central Texas, the emergence of a potential data center site at this location is a signal worth taking seriously—even if the project never gets built at this specific address.
Data center development has a gravitational effect on surrounding real estate. When a major facility announces, land values within a few miles tend to move. Supporting businesses—fiber installers, cooling equipment suppliers, electrical contractors, security firms—cluster nearby. The area's commercial and light industrial zoning demand increases. Investors who move early, before a project announcement becomes public knowledge, capture the most upside.
The ROI math on data center-adjacent land has been compelling in other Texas markets. In the DFW metroplex and northern Austin suburbs, parcels near announced data center campuses have appreciated substantially faster than comparable land in surrounding areas. The Fort Hood corridor is a different market—smaller, less liquid, less infrastructure-dense—but the underlying dynamic is the same.
Infrastructure development tends to be self-reinforcing: the first major facility proves the market, and subsequent projects face lower barriers because the power, fiber, and permitting groundwork already exists.
For direct investors in the data center asset class itself, the key question is whether this site can attract a creditworthy anchor tenant—a hyperscaler, a federal agency, or a large enterprise—before construction begins. Build-to-suit deals with strong tenants underwrite the risk in ways that speculative development simply cannot. Given Fort Hood's military context, federal agency interest is at least plausible and worth monitoring.
